Last year, the programme saw over 72,000 students participate across Ireland. The programme features four key tasks, including Tracing Our Food's Journey, Sowing & Growing, Roots to Recipes, and Balanced Bites. At the end of the term, students will submit one project per class that reflects on their learning. This can take the form of a poem, story, artwork, video, or presentation.

Now in its 19th year, the Incredible Edibles programme teaches primary school students about the benefits of eating Irish-grown produce and understanding where their food comes from, all through hands-on participation in growing their own fruit and vegetables at school.
